
The ketogenic diet, a high-fat, low-carbohydrate eating plan, has gained popularity for its potential weight loss and health benefits, but its impact on breastfeeding mothers remains a topic of concern. Many new mothers wonder whether adopting a keto lifestyle could affect their breast milk supply, as maintaining adequate milk production is crucial for their baby's nutrition and growth. While some anecdotal evidence suggests that keto might reduce milk supply, scientific research on this specific issue is limited. Factors such as calorie intake, hydration, and overall nutritional balance play significant roles in lactation, and any restrictive diet, including keto, requires careful consideration to ensure both mother and baby receive the necessary nutrients. Consulting healthcare professionals before making dietary changes is essential for breastfeeding mothers to address individual needs and concerns.

Impact of Ketosis on Milk Production
Ketosis, a metabolic state where the body burns fat for fuel instead of carbohydrates, has gained popularity for weight loss and health benefits. However, for breastfeeding mothers, the question arises: does this dietary shift impact milk production? The answer lies in understanding how ketosis affects energy availability and nutrient composition. During ketosis, the body produces ketones as an alternative energy source, which can be passed to the infant through breast milk. While ketones are a viable energy source, the concern is whether the reduced carbohydrate intake in a ketogenic diet might limit the mother’s overall energy reserves, potentially affecting milk supply. Studies suggest that as long as caloric intake remains adequate, ketosis itself does not inherently reduce milk production. However, the quality of the diet—ensuring sufficient hydration, electrolytes, and essential nutrients—plays a critical role in maintaining lactation.
From a practical standpoint, breastfeeding mothers considering a ketogenic diet must prioritize nutrient density. A well-formulated keto diet includes healthy fats (e.g., avocados, nuts, and olive oil), moderate protein (e.g., lean meats, fish), and low-carb vegetables (e.g., spinach, broccoli). Aim for a daily caloric intake of at least 1,800–2,200 calories, depending on activity level and individual needs. Hydration is equally vital; aim for 3–4 liters of water daily, as dehydration can directly impact milk supply. Additionally, monitor electrolyte levels, particularly sodium, potassium, and magnesium, as ketosis can increase their excretion. Supplementation or dietary sources (e.g., bone broth, leafy greens) can help maintain balance.
Comparatively, the impact of ketosis on milk production differs from other dietary restrictions. For instance, severe calorie restriction or low-fat diets are more likely to reduce milk supply due to insufficient energy availability. In contrast, a ketogenic diet, when properly executed, provides ample energy from fats and proteins. However, the transition phase into ketosis (often the first 2–4 weeks) may temporarily affect milk supply due to hormonal adjustments and potential fatigue. To mitigate this, gradually reduce carbohydrate intake rather than adopting a strict keto diet abruptly. Monitoring milk supply during this period using tools like weighted feeds or tracking diaper output can help identify any issues early.
Persuasively, the key to maintaining milk production while in ketosis lies in individualized approach and vigilance. Not all mothers will respond the same way; factors like pre-pregnancy weight, overall health, and stress levels play a role. Consulting a healthcare provider or lactation specialist before starting a ketogenic diet is essential. For mothers experiencing a dip in milk supply, increasing calorie intake, adding lactation-boosting foods (e.g., oats, fenugreek), and ensuring adequate rest can help. Conversely, if milk supply remains stable, the ketogenic diet may offer benefits such as sustained energy levels and improved metabolic health, which can positively impact overall breastfeeding experience.
In conclusion, ketosis does not inherently reduce breast milk supply, but its success depends on careful planning and monitoring. By focusing on nutrient density, hydration, and individualized adjustments, breastfeeding mothers can safely explore a ketogenic diet without compromising lactation. Practical tips, such as gradual dietary changes and regular supply assessments, ensure a smooth transition. Ultimately, the impact of ketosis on milk production is manageable with the right approach, allowing mothers to align their dietary goals with their breastfeeding journey.

Nutrient Deficiencies and Lactation
Breastfeeding mothers often scrutinize their diets to ensure optimal milk supply and quality, but restrictive diets like keto can inadvertently lead to nutrient deficiencies critical for lactation. The keto diet, characterized by its high-fat, low-carbohydrate structure, limits foods rich in essential nutrients such as vitamin D, magnesium, and folate. These deficiencies can compromise not only maternal health but also the nutritional content of breast milk, potentially affecting infant development. For instance, inadequate vitamin D levels in a mother’s diet can result in insufficient vitamin D in breast milk, increasing the risk of rickets in infants.
To mitigate these risks, lactating mothers on keto must prioritize nutrient-dense foods within the diet’s constraints. Incorporating fatty fish like salmon or mackerel provides both healthy fats and vitamin D, while nuts and seeds such as almonds and pumpkin seeds offer magnesium and zinc. However, reliance on supplements may become necessary, particularly for folate and iron, which are less readily available in keto-friendly foods. A daily prenatal vitamin formulated for breastfeeding mothers can help bridge these gaps, but consultation with a healthcare provider is essential to determine appropriate dosages and avoid over-supplementation.
Comparatively, non-keto diets often include a broader range of nutrient sources, reducing the risk of deficiencies. For example, whole grains, legumes, and fortified cereals—typically excluded in keto—are rich in B vitamins and iron, which support both maternal energy levels and infant neurological development. Lactating mothers on keto must be vigilant about monitoring their nutrient intake, as the diet’s restrictive nature can exacerbate deficiencies already common during lactation. Regular blood tests to assess nutrient levels can provide a proactive approach to addressing potential shortfalls before they impact milk supply or quality.
Practical tips for keto-following breastfeeding mothers include meal planning to ensure a variety of nutrient-dense foods and staying hydrated, as dehydration can further stress the body during lactation. Additionally, tracking symptoms like fatigue, weakness, or changes in milk supply can signal underlying deficiencies. While keto can be adapted to support lactation, it requires careful planning and potentially more reliance on supplements than other diets. Ultimately, the goal is to balance the diet’s benefits with the nutritional demands of breastfeeding, ensuring both mother and infant thrive.

Caloric Intake vs. Milk Supply
Breastfeeding mothers often worry that dietary changes, like adopting a ketogenic diet, might impact their milk supply. Central to this concern is the relationship between caloric intake and lactation. While the keto diet emphasizes low-carb, high-fat foods, its restrictive nature can inadvertently reduce overall calorie consumption, which is critical for milk production. The body requires approximately 300-500 extra calories daily to support lactation, and falling below this threshold can signal to the body that resources are scarce, potentially decreasing milk supply.
To maintain milk production while on keto, mothers must carefully monitor their caloric intake. A common mistake is assuming that high-fat foods automatically equate to sufficient calories. For example, a diet consisting primarily of avocado, cheese, and nuts might be keto-compliant but may not meet the caloric needs of a breastfeeding mother. Tracking daily intake using apps or journals can help ensure that calorie levels remain adequate. Aim for a minimum of 1,800 calories daily, adjusting based on activity level and individual metabolism.
Comparatively, non-keto diets often include calorie-dense carbohydrates, which can simplify meeting caloric goals. On keto, achieving the same caloric intake requires intentional planning. Incorporating calorie-dense, keto-friendly foods like full-fat dairy, fatty fish, and oils can help bridge this gap. For instance, adding a tablespoon of olive oil (120 calories) to meals or snacking on a handful of macadamia nuts (200 calories per ounce) can boost caloric intake without exceeding carb limits.
Practical tips include spacing meals and snacks evenly throughout the day to maintain energy levels and milk production. Staying hydrated is equally important, as dehydration can mimic hunger and lead to under-eating. Mothers should also monitor their milk supply and baby’s behavior for signs of insufficiency, such as decreased wet diapers or poor weight gain. If concerns arise, consulting a lactation specialist or healthcare provider is essential to adjust the diet or explore alternative solutions.
In conclusion, while keto can be compatible with breastfeeding, caloric intake remains the linchpin of milk supply. By prioritizing calorie-dense foods, monitoring intake, and staying attuned to the body’s signals, mothers can navigate keto without compromising lactation. Balancing dietary restrictions with nutritional needs ensures both mother and baby thrive during this critical period.

Hydration Levels and Breastfeeding
Breastfeeding mothers often hear the adage, "Drink more water to boost milk supply," but the relationship between hydration and lactation is more nuanced than simply increasing fluid intake. While the ketogenic diet’s emphasis on low-carb, high-fat foods doesn’t inherently target hydration, its diuretic effect in the initial stages can lead to increased fluid loss, potentially impacting milk production. Dehydration, even mild, can reduce blood volume, which in turn limits the body’s ability to deliver nutrients to the mammary glands, where milk is synthesized. For breastfeeding mothers on keto, monitoring hydration becomes critical to ensure both maternal health and consistent milk supply.
To maintain optimal hydration while breastfeeding on keto, start by tracking fluid intake and urine color, a simple yet effective indicator of hydration status. Aim for at least 3 liters (12 cups) of water daily, adjusting based on activity level, climate, and individual needs. Electrolyte balance is equally vital, as keto can deplete minerals like sodium, potassium, and magnesium, which are essential for fluid retention and overall function. Incorporate electrolyte-rich foods such as spinach, avocados, and nuts, or consider supplements under professional guidance. Avoid relying solely on caffeinated or sugary beverages, as they can interfere with hydration and disrupt milk supply.
Practical tips for keto-friendly hydration include carrying a reusable water bottle to sip throughout the day, adding herbal teas or infused water for variety, and consuming water-dense foods like cucumbers, zucchini, and berries. Breastfeeding mothers should also drink to thirst, especially during nursing sessions, as the hormone oxytocin released during breastfeeding can trigger thirst cues. Monitoring milk output and baby’s satisfaction (e.g., consistent wet diapers, steady weight gain) can provide indirect feedback on hydration adequacy. If concerns arise, consult a lactation specialist or healthcare provider to rule out dehydration-related supply issues.
Comparatively, while keto’s diuretic phase may temporarily challenge hydration, it doesn’t inherently reduce breast milk supply if managed properly. Non-keto breastfeeding mothers also face hydration risks, particularly if they neglect fluid intake due to fatigue or busyness. The key difference lies in keto’s electrolyte dynamics, which require proactive management. By prioritizing hydration and electrolyte balance, breastfeeding mothers on keto can support both their lactation goals and the diet’s metabolic benefits without compromise.
In conclusion, hydration levels are a cornerstone of breastfeeding success, particularly for those on keto. The diet’s initial fluid shifts demand vigilance, but with mindful strategies—adequate water intake, electrolyte replenishment, and responsive hydration habits—mothers can sustain milk supply while adhering to keto principles. Hydration isn’t just about drinking water; it’s about creating a balanced internal environment that supports the demanding process of lactation. For keto-following breastfeeding mothers, staying hydrated is not optional—it’s essential.

Hormonal Changes on Keto Diet
The keto diet, characterized by its high-fat, low-carbohydrate composition, induces a metabolic state called ketosis, where the body burns fat for energy instead of glucose. This shift triggers hormonal changes that can affect lactation. One key hormone is insulin, which decreases significantly on keto due to reduced carbohydrate intake. Lower insulin levels can influence prolactin, the hormone responsible for milk production. While some studies suggest insulin and prolactin are indirectly linked, the exact mechanism remains unclear. However, anecdotal reports from breastfeeding mothers on keto often mention a potential decrease in milk supply, raising concerns about the diet’s impact on lactation hormones.
Another hormonal factor to consider is cortisol, the body’s primary stress hormone. Transitioning to ketosis can initially increase cortisol levels as the body adapts to a new metabolic state. Elevated cortisol may interfere with oxytocin, the hormone essential for milk ejection (the "let-down" reflex). If oxytocin function is disrupted, milk flow can be hindered, potentially reducing the overall supply. Breastfeeding mothers should monitor stress levels and ensure adequate hydration and rest to mitigate this effect. Incorporating stress-reducing practices like mindfulness or gentle exercise may also help balance cortisol levels during keto adaptation.
For mothers considering keto while breastfeeding, monitoring caloric intake is crucial. A severe calorie deficit, often unintentional on keto due to reduced appetite, can lower leptin levels, a hormone regulating hunger and energy balance. Low leptin signals the body to conserve energy, which may prioritize bodily functions over milk production. To avoid this, ensure a daily caloric intake of at least 1,800–2,200 calories, depending on activity level. Including nutrient-dense fats like avocado, nuts, and full-fat dairy can help meet energy needs without exceeding carb limits. Consulting a lactation specialist or dietitian can provide personalized guidance.
Finally, the keto diet’s impact on thyroid hormones warrants attention. Ketosis can lower T3 levels, the active form of thyroid hormone, which plays a role in metabolism and energy regulation. While this effect is typically mild, it could theoretically influence milk supply if the body perceives a metabolic slowdown. Breastfeeding mothers on keto should monitor symptoms of thyroid dysfunction, such as fatigue or unexplained weight changes, and consider regular thyroid function tests. Incorporating selenium-rich foods like Brazil nuts and iodine sources like seaweed can support thyroid health during keto. Balancing hormonal changes through mindful dietary choices and monitoring can help maintain milk supply while adhering to keto principles.
